DH Labs Revelation Pure Silver XLR Interconnect 1m

Featured Replies

Further Information: 

 

 

  • Six Pure Silver conductors in an interleaved helical array.
  • Each conductor is individually insulated in an Air Matrix dielectric.
  • Bespoke XLR connectors with high-quality gold-plated copper contact points.
  • Smooth and detailed without sounding hash or edgy.
  • Manufactured in the USA using superior materials from the finest sources.
